Output 81d831f3906e77af0465be90a3b8f7fc647c00012a983e43630a9be843b2fc81:12

value
8617506
script pubkey
OP_0 OP_PUSHBYTES_20 de19837bb1f48d8d87512a7116ac11e1350cf6b7
address
ltc1qmcvcx7a37jxcmp639fc3dtq3uy6sea4hnf4gkx
transaction
81d831f3906e77af0465be90a3b8f7fc647c00012a983e43630a9be843b2fc81
spent
true